Get started5 Ryes Close is a three-bedroom detached house in King's Lynn (PE33 0BS). It has a recorded floor area of 91 m² (around 980 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(July 2017) shows an E (score 50),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 78),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 3.2%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£343,000 is 11.1%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£315/sq ft) was about 63.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old February 2022 for £308,800.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
